
Worked on the pi-hole/docker-pi-hole and pi-hole/docs repositories, focusing on security and user guidance improvements. Addressed a key configuration issue by reverting Docker secret handling for the web server API password, removing the file-based WEBPASSWORD_FILE approach and restoring the FTLCONF_webserver_api_password environment variable, thereby standardizing secret management and enhancing maintainability. Updated documentation to reflect the project’s new X (formerly Twitter) handle, improving user engagement and discoverability. Demonstrated skills in DevOps, Docker, and documentation, utilizing Shell scripting and Markdown to implement changes. Coordinated updates across repositories, ensuring consistency and traceability through Git-based workflows and collaborative development practices.
February 2025 monthly summary: Key deliverables across two repositories (pi-hole/docker-pi-hole and pi-hole/docs) focused on security-conscious config changes and improved user guidance. Key features delivered: Documentation update reflecting the new X (formerly Twitter) handle to improve discoverability and official engagement. Major bugs fixed: Reverted Docker secret handling for the web server API password, removing the WEBPASSWORD_FILE-based configuration and restoring the FTLCONF_webserver_api_password environment variable usage. Overall impact and accomplishments: Strengthened security posture and maintainability by standardizing on environment-variable secret management, while improving user-facing documentation and official channel presence. Technologies/skills demonstrated: Docker secret management, environment variable configuration, Git-based change traceability, documentation practices, and cross-repo collaboration.
February 2025 monthly summary: Key deliverables across two repositories (pi-hole/docker-pi-hole and pi-hole/docs) focused on security-conscious config changes and improved user guidance. Key features delivered: Documentation update reflecting the new X (formerly Twitter) handle to improve discoverability and official engagement. Major bugs fixed: Reverted Docker secret handling for the web server API password, removing the WEBPASSWORD_FILE-based configuration and restoring the FTLCONF_webserver_api_password environment variable usage. Overall impact and accomplishments: Strengthened security posture and maintainability by standardizing on environment-variable secret management, while improving user-facing documentation and official channel presence. Technologies/skills demonstrated: Docker secret management, environment variable configuration, Git-based change traceability, documentation practices, and cross-repo collaboration.

Overview of all repositories you've contributed to across your timeline